    I personally think that the success of the Palme d'Or is nothing more than discussions and concerns about "modernity". Sex is the source of modern people's ability to capture energy and express their desires. Lies are an essential element in interpersonal relationships. Video tape is the link between the two. Through such a modern medium, the inseparable tension between sex and lies is reiterated. Soderbergh deliberately omits all visual representations of sexuality, but instead uses the conflict between the other two to gradually reveal the connotation of sexuality and the misfortunes it extends, that is, "foreword other things to evoke the chanted words". Events without cause and effect are interspersed with each other, deepening the alienation of the characters and the de-dramatization of the plot, and constructing the current living state of modern people. Deep enough, but not stunning enough.
